Gravity Mass Flow meter Rheonik RHM-12

Rheonik Coriolis Mass Flow Meter




The RHM 12 is an economical meter which has been in production for over 15 years. This meter has been

optimized for applications which require extreme stability and fast response. As with all other Rheonik meters, this model is based on the patented Omega tube design with increased signal to noise ratio.


The RHM 12 can measure flow rates up to 10 kg/min (21 lb/min) with extremely fast response times and

excellent repeatability. A true solution, particulary for application such as batching where fast response
times are needed, manufactured by Rheonik, the mass flowmeter experts




This unique design, which offers excellent performance and reliability, has created the most satisfied customers worldwide. Unlike other mass flowmeters,  Rheonik uses a patented torsion swinger with the Omega shape and support bars which results in high accuracy measurement, which is independent of pressure, even at very low flow velocities. The meter has also extremely good repeatability and high stability for critical applications.

FEATURES
The outstanding features include:
  • Standart pressure rating upto 790 bar (11458 psi)
  • Temperature rating from -196 to 350 Deg C (-320 to 662 Deg F)
  • Mass flow uncertainly down to 0.12%
  • Density uncertainly down to 0.5%
  • Repeatability better than 0.05%
  • Typical measuring ranges between 1 and 100 kg/min
  • Accurately measure low flow rate down to 750 g/min
  • Unique robust torsiondriven oscillation system
  • Precess Connection customization available
  • Minimum pipe footprint versions available
  • Approved for use in hazarddous areas
  • Satinless steel case
  • Removable connection manifold version available for easy and efficient maintenance
  • Remote and compact transmitter versions vailable 
ADVANTAGES
  • Torsion oscillator design assures a stable and drift free measurement with excellent signal to noise rations.
  • Resilient to external noise and vibration
  • Insensitive to pipe presssure changes
  • Robust tube wall thickness provides increased operational safety in abrasive applications
  • Corrosion resistant
  • Long sensor life guaranteed due to low mechanical stresses in the meter mechanism
  • No moving parts to wear or fail

PERFORMANCE RHM 03
Max Flow 5 kg/min (11 lb/min)

1. Standart Model



2. Optimized Low Flow Models* / optimized to be operated between 0.015 x Q max and 0.3 x Qmax



3.  Gold Line Models/ application fine tuned meters

Repeatability : better ± 0.05 % of rate
Temperature : better ± 1°C




For serial (single pipe/path) sanitary design Qmax is 2.5 kg/min (50%). Data above refer to standard wall thickness. 
Error of reading (including zero drift) indications refer to reference conditions H2O, 18-24°C (66-76°F), 1-3 bar (15-45 psi).
RHM sensor do not suffer from pressure effect due to torsional oscillation and semi circle (non-deforming) measurement section.
Temperature changes of +/- 25°C around the operating point are negligible.
Pressure drop refers to Newton liquids, with parallel measuring loops and block/manifold connection.
Nominal flow refers to approx. 10 m/s (33 ft/sec) velocity in measuring loops for best performance. 
Calibration to customer range, with increased accuracy, possible.
